Geraldine Brooks, Saeed Jones win Anisfield-Wolf prize

Novels by Geraldine Brooks and Lan Samantha Chang and poetry by Saeed Jones are among this year’s winners of the Anisfield-Wolf Book Awards, presented for literature “that confronts racism and explores diversity.” The journalist and activist Charlayne Hunter-Gault was honored for lifetime achievement. Besides Brooks’ “Horse,” Chang’s “The Family Chao” and Jones’ “Alive at the End of the World,” judges also cited Matthew F. Delmont’s nonfiction “Half American: The Epic Story of African Americans Fighting World War II at Home and Abroad." Previous winners include the Rev. Martin Luther King Jr., Toni Morrison, Nadine Gordimer and Zadie Smith.

Here are the 2023 Anisfield-Wolf Book Awards winners | Crain's Cleveland Business

The Cleveland Foundation on Monday evening, April 3, unveiled two winners in the fiction category and one each in nonfiction, poetry and lifetime achievement for the 88th annual awards, which are the only national juried prize for literature that confronts racism and explores diversity.
